Job details:  Occupational Therapist required to support with a 6 months project around single handed care, reviewing care packages. Requires skills and experience of manual handling, specialist equipment, risk assessment and joint working with social care colleagues. Hybrid working. Flexibility needed to accommodate care calls, this could include early mornings. JD available on request:

  • This postholder will work effectively as a member of the Community Occupational Therapy service based in the First Contact team and will provide occupational therapy for customers within the community, undertaking and reviewing assessments of customers in conjunction with other professionals.  Ensuring casework is carried out in an appropriate and timely fashion.
  • The post holder will support the Council’s statutory duties in relation to Adult Social Care, ensuring that the principles of ‘Prevent, Reduce & Delay’ are applied at all times including a focus on strengthbased approaches to assessment and support.
  • The role will assess customers and their carer’s needs, helping to identify and set goals to increase their independence and prevent the need for longer term services.  As well as providing professional advice and guidance in methods of overcoming issues of daily living by using new techniques to aid rehabilitation. The post holder will demonstrate skills and knowledge in equipment, adaptions and moving and handling principles. They will undertake assessments autonomously contribute to safeguarding, mental capacity assessments and best interest decisions.
  • This role must be able to work effectively as part of a team and along with a range of agencies and professionals, and using appropriate interventions, values, and knowledge base to work with adults and their carers to achieve the best possible outcomes.

Travel is an essential part of this job and although being a car user is not essential, the expectation would be that postholders can travel across the borough, within a reasonable timescale.
